Outline of the Course
- Unit 1: British period study and enquiry: Pitt to Peel 1783-1853
- Unit 2: Non-British period study: The Cold War in Asia 1945-93
- Unit 3: Depth Study – China and its Rulers 1839-1989
- Unit 4: Topic based essay – Coursework Assessment
